REGINA – A woman is recovering from stab wounds after an alleged domestic dispute turned violent in Regina on Wednesday night.
Police went to a house in the 1600 block of Angus Street last night where they found a woman with a knife wound in her abdomen.

The woman is expected to recover.
Police say a man who is known to the woman is now facing charges.
